Distinguish between Bill of Exchange & Promissory Note.

अंतर स्पष्ट करें

उत्तर

No.  Basis of Difference Bill of Exchange Promissory Note
1 Undertaking It contains an unconditional order. It contains an unconditional undertaking.
2 Number of Parties There are three parties:
  • Drawer [maker]
  • Drawee
  • Payee
There are two parties:
  • Maker
  • Payee
3 Drawer of the instrument A creditor draws a Bill on the debtor. A debtor executes a promotion in favor of a creditor.
4 Identify the parties Both Drawer and payee can be one and the same person. The maker himself can not be the payee because the same person cannot be both the promisor and promisee.
